Description




This 1986 Tartan 34-2, has been well taken care off and upgraded, She features newer standing rigging (2022), a LiPO4 house battery, a good sail inventory that includes a newer mainsail to only name a few highlights. The boat can easily be single-handed, she has made a couple trips to the Bahamas and is being actively sailed locally.  Designed to be a comfortable performance cruiser and racer, the Tartan 34-2, a Sparkman & Stevens creation, is a high-quality craft known for its superior built and solid reputation. Highlights:Engine and injector service (Mar 2026)New Antifoul (Oct 2025)Complete Buff and Wax (4/2025)Standing rigging new as of Sept 2022 Lithium LiPO4 house battery (April 2024)New Precision Sails Dacron mainsail (2023)Good sail inventory with 1 mainsail, 1 mainsail spare, 1 genoa, 1 storm jib and two spinnakersVesper Watchmate class B AIS send/receive wifi network enabled (June 2023)Deck repainted by previous ownerMechanical:27 HP Yanmar, hours unknownEngine service and injectors serviced (March 2026)New belts in 2024Replaced all 4 motor mounts with stainless mounts and aligned shaft (Jan 2023)Replaced raw water pump (July 2023)Conventional packing gland and carbon packing, packing gland hose and packing replaced (Feb 2021)Sails & Rigging / Canvas:Doyle 120 jib-cut genoaNorth Sails #3 storm jibNew Precision Sails dacron conventional main sail with 2 reef points (2023)Spare conventional mainRed, white, blue, asymmetrical spinnaker Orange and Black, symmetrical spinnaker Carbon spinnaker poleJohn Ramsey Rigging replaced all standing rigging, chain plates, mast wiring, rebuilt masthead and cranes (Sept 2022)Chain plates re-bedded (4/2025)Hydraulic Backstay rebuilt Summer 2023Sunbrella Navy bimini replaced Fall 2023Electronics / Electrical:Vesper Marine AIS with wifi networkGarmin chartplotterRaymarine ST60 series wind, depth, and speed instruments mounted above companionwayStandard Horizon marine VHF with AIS receiveLightning protection for VHF antenna system180 Ah Paoweric Lithium battery new in 2024AGM starter battery (Oct 2022)200W solar array and Renogy 30A battery charging system. [The boat draws 90Ah in 24 hours in normal sailing conditions and is fully charged by early afternoon most days.]3000W Renogy Pure Sine Wave inverterLED lighting throughoutSeveral USB portsShore Power battery charger and 30A cableGalley:Eno 2 burner stoveCold Machine refrigerator new in 2020Available foot pump for galley sinkNew Kuuma 6 gallon Hot water heater (July 2023)Plumbing:Jabsco manual head and all new blackwater system (replaced in the last 4 years)New rotomolded 15 gallon blackwater tank (Oct. 2021)Jabsco macerator pump for overboard discharge where allowableNew faucet in the head sink (July 2024)Ground Tackle:20kg (44 lbs) Rocna anchor, 50’ chain, 150’ rodeDanforth Aluminum backup anchor, 200’ rodeAccommodations:Quarter double berth portForward cabin v-berthV-berth with custom memory foam mattress Wet headCockpit cushions foam replaced Nov 2023.Drop down table in salon cabin for entertainingWater heater works with engine heat or 120v powerTen opening portlights, 3 opening hatches most with screensThree ventilation fansSun shades for hatchesTankage:Fuel: 23 GallonsWater: 57 GallonsHolding: 15 gallonsOther: Safety equipment – Jack lines, harness/life jackets with strobes, tethers, throw cushion, flares, fire extinguishers, air horn, lifesling MOB deviceExterior teak will be finished with Cetol light and Cetol glossStainless cleaned and protected with Flitz17 inch 3 blade fixed bronze prop (purchased in Oct 2021)Length 34’Beam 11’Draft 2.0 meters, 6’7” Fin keelBridge clearance 50 feetDisclaimerThe company offers the details of this vessel in good faith but cannot guarantee or warrant the accuracy of this information nor warrant the condition of the vessel.
